Former President Mahinda Rajapaksa has been invited to the special SLFP conference scheduled to be held at the Presidential Secretariat with incumbent President Maithripala Sirisena presiding on Nov. 3, party sources said yesterday.
A senior SLFP minister told The Island that it was mandatory for all SLFP MPs to attend the conference and each would be informed of it in writing. The invitation letters would be posted to all SLFP MPs today, he said.
The talks would be held without any conditions. The conference is expected to take up the SLFP’s campaign at the forthcoming local government polls and the participants were expected to express their views on how to make SLFP a formidable force in the election and to assign tasks to the electoral organisers, the minister said.
